Struggling Boeing Corporation Brings in Experienced Aviation Manager Ortberg as CEO

Boeing has appointed Robert 'Kelly' Ortberg, an experienced aviation executive, as its new CEO. Ortberg will take over on August 8th and will have the challenging task of addressing safety issues and improving quality control.

The company reported a quarterly loss of $1.44 billion, much higher than expected. Ortberg, who previously led Rockwell Collins, brings over 35 years of industry experience to the role.

Boeing is facing significant challenges, including the grounding of the 737 MAX, declining commercial deliveries, and a criminal fraud conspiracy charge related to the 737 MAX crashes. The appointment of Ortberg comes earlier than anticipated, as outgoing CEO Dave Calhoun had planned to step down at the end of the year.

Boeing's new CEO will need to navigate the company through these turbulent times and work towards a turnaround in the business performance.

Boeing taps Kelly Ortberg as new CEO, reports wider-than-expected Q2 loss and revenue miss

Economy
Finance
Boeing named former Rockwell Collins CEO Kelly Ortberg as its new president and CEO, replacing outgoing head Dave Calhoun. The company reported wider-than-expected Q2 loss and revenue miss. Boeing chairman Steven Mollenkopf said Ortberg has the right skills to lead the troubled aerospace giant in its next chapter.
